Suge was behind Pac's death

Ridiculous conspiracy theory that has no basis in reality. The worst kept secret in unsolved celebrity murder mysteries is that Orlando 'Baby Lane' Anderson murdered Tupac with the help of his uncle Keith Davis and 2 other men. Several confidential informants and Davis himself have implicated Anderson as the trigger man. Anderson bragged openly about his act before he himself was killed in a gang shootout less than 2 years later. He had the means, the motive, and was involved in an altercation (which was caught on tape (https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=IPGrIQJyS5Y)) with Pac/Suge and their entourage just 3 hours before the hit.

Two independent investigations concluded that Anderson and the South Side Crips were offered a $1 million bounty by Puffy/Biggie (and others involved in the dispute like Jimmy Henchman) to kill Tupac and Suge.

Think about it... why would Suge put himself in the line of fire? Wasn't he shot in the head during the Tupac hit? That makes absolutely no sense.

What's up with this contract hit ish? From what I've heard, Anderson and co. shot up Pac and Suge out of revenge for getting jumped earlier. Nothing about Diddy calling in a hit

The story goes that as the feud between Bad Boy and Death Row escalated from just words to fights/armed conflicts, Suge kidnapped an associate of Puffy's and tortured him trying to get info about where Puff stayed whenever he was in Cali. Of course when Puff found out about that he freaked out. He started paying the South Side Crips protection money to act as his bodyguards whenever he was on the West Coast. He also put out a bounty on Death Row members' chains (then later allegedly the $1 million contract on Tupac and Suge).

Baby Lane and some others jumped a Death Row member and snatched his chain in LA. Later in Vegas the guy who got his chain snatched spotted Lane in the lobby of the casino, told his whole crew including Pac and Suge and then the melee happened that was caught on tape.

And naturally after getting his ass whooped, Lane got some of his people together and they drove around looking for Pac and crew, found him, shot him and Suge. Pac died.
